Orange recycling project hits a snag

The collection should be running smoothly next week.

Durban Solid Waste has reassured worried Toti residents that the orange recycle refuse bags are still being collected and distributed.

This follows a complaint from a Vasco Da Gama Road resident that the bags have not been collected in her street for about three weeks.

“There is a new contractor who is now servicing the southern areas of eThekwini,” said Zanele Dlamini of DSW education and waste minimisation. “He started on 1 October and we are aware that he is missing some roads. We are rectifying the problem and we should have the collection running smoothly next week.

We apologise for the non-collection of bags in some areas.”

To report non-collection and to request bags, householders must call the helpline on 031-303-1665 for orange bags.
